Adults Can Take an ADHD Online Test to Assess Their Symptoms

ADHD (attention deficit hyperactivity disorder), a neurodevelopmental condition which causes impulsivity, hyperactivity and problems with concentration, is commonly referred to as ADHD. It can also affect children as well as adults.

psychology-today-logo.pngHealthcare professionals use a variety of tools to determine ADHD. These tools may include questions or answers to questions regarding past or present problems.

The signs

ADHD symptoms can affect how the person behaves as well as how they perform during the day. For many people suffering from ADHD, these symptoms can be a source of stress and anxiety. They can also make it difficult for those with ADHD to maintain healthy relationships.

If you or someone you know is suffering from symptoms that are connected to ADHD, it's important to get a diagnosis early as possible. This is a condition that can have a profound impact on the entire family, and an accurate diagnosis could lead to coping strategies and treatment options.

Telehealth services allow quick diagnosis, treatment, and therapy for ADHD (and other disorders) through an online consultation. These services promise a speedier and less expensive way to be diagnosed than traditional methods of testing, referrals and therapy, which can take weeks, or even months.

These companies charge a single fee for a quick assessment and then recommend medication or therapy if needed. This service comes with certain dangers.

The most frequent mistake is misdiagnosis. risk. This can lead to an incorrect treatment or the worsening of the condition. Kustow claims that these tools are only an overview of a person and cannot be relied on to identify a disorder. The condition can affect the person's daily life, so it is important to not diagnose the problem too quickly.

Treatment

There are a variety of treatment options for adults suffering from ADHD that include medication and therapy for behavior. Therapy can help you identify and eliminate unhealthy coping mechanisms and help you reduce symptoms.

Symptoms of ADHD usually begin in childhood and often continue into adulthood. If they're not addressed, they can impact your job and relationships, which can have a negative impact on your health.

ADHD patients typically have co-occurring issues like depression or anxiety which can make it difficult to treat. It is crucial to collaborate with professionals to ensure your care is coordinated.

A psychiatrist or psychologist can conduct a thorough evaluation to confirm your diagnosis and figure out the best treatment option for you. They'll review your family history, analyze your symptoms, and examine any other mental health issues that you might have.

It can take a long time to get an accurate diagnosis. A doctor will look at your non-verbal cues and question you about your previous. Then the doctor will take notes on the most problematic patterns.

Even when you have a specific diagnosis, it is still vital to talk to an experienced psychologist or psychiatrist who is knowledgeable about the condition you are experiencing. They will then be able to determine the most effective combination of medication and treatment.

If you've been diagnosed with ADHD You'll need to get treatment as soon as possible. The aim is to minimize or eliminate symptoms and live an enjoyable, normal life.

Treatment usually consists of psychotherapy and medication like Cognitive Behavior Therapy (CBT). It is extremely effective in treating symptoms.

Lifestyle changes are sometimes necessary like a better sleep schedule or a more nutritious diet. These changes will make you feel more prepared to face stressful situations and difficult people.
